Finding free books online without registration is easier than you think, and I’ve spent years exploring the best options. Project Gutenberg is a classic choice, offering timeless literature like 'Pride and Prejudice' and 'Dracula' in multiple formats. No accounts, no fuss—just download and read. Open Library is another gem; it’s like a digital version of your local library, where you can borrow eBooks for free. Their read-in-browser feature means you don’t even need to log in.

For more variety, ManyBooks curates free titles from genres like sci-fi, romance, and thriller. Their minimalist design makes browsing a breeze. If you prefer audiobooks, Librivox has thousands of public domain works read by volunteers. The quality varies, but it’s a fantastic resource for classics. Lastly, Google Books has a 'Free to read' section where you can access full novels without signing in. These platforms are lifesavers for voracious readers who value simplicity.

How can you read a book online for free with no registration?

4 Answers2025-07-17 03:29:32
I've found a few reliable methods. Public domain books are gold—sites like Project Gutenberg offer thousands of classics like 'Pride and Prejudice' and 'Frankenstein' with zero registration. Many libraries also partner with apps like Libby or OverDrive, where you can borrow e-books using just a library card number (no personal details needed). Another trick is checking author or publisher websites—some indie writers post free chapters or full works to attract readers. For contemporary books, platforms like Open Library occasionally have free digital loans, though availability varies. Always watch out for legit sources to avoid sketchy sites that might ask for info later.
